The drinking water purification plant construction industry plays a crucial role in securing access to clean water. It involves companies that design, build, and maintain facilities that provide safe drinking water. These firms specialize in various technologies, such as filtration and disinfection, and serve municipalities, industries, and agricultural sectors. As global demand for clean water continues to rise, the industry is seeing advancements in eco-friendly practices, digital monitoring, and innovative purification methods. Notably, issues surrounding climate change are prompting a greater emphasis on sustainable water management solutions, making this sector increasingly vital.

4. Ecoimpianti Sud S.R.L.


Ecoimpianti Sud S.R.L., based in Brindisi, Apulia, Italy, has been a player in the water treatment industry since its establishment in 1987. Founded by Ing. Francesco Maria Silvestrini, the company focuses on the design, construction, and management of water purification systems tailored to meet the needs of various sectors, including municipal, industrial, and agricultural. With a team of over 20 professionals, including engineers, chemists, and biologists, Ecoimpianti Sud provides high-level services aimed at achieving technical, economic, and environmental goals for its clients. The company operates more than 130 purification and potabilization plants across Italy, showcasing its capability and commitment to effective water management. Ecoimpianti Sud also partners with recognized entities like Culligan and Techase to enhance its technological offerings, including innovative sludge dehydration systems. Their adherence to international quality and environmental standards, as evidenced by their ISO certifications, further underscores their dedication to excellence in water treatment.

18. Rook Pijpleidingbouw B.V.


Rook Pijpleidingbouw B.V., based in Sint Jansklooster, Overijssel, Netherlands, is a family-owned company that has been a key player in the water treatment industry since its founding in 1969. With a workforce of 11 to 50 employees, the company specializes in the design, construction, and maintenance of water purification installations. Rook Pijpleidingbouw serves a variety of clients in the water sector, providing tailored solutions for both drinking and industrial water needs. Their unique approach includes managing the entire production process in-house, from engineering to manufacturing components such as pipes and tanks. This capability allows them to execute projects efficiently and with a high degree of customization. The company has built a reputation for reliability and expertise, having completed numerous projects for drinking water companies and other industrial clients. Their commitment to quality is underscored by various certifications, including ISO 9001 and VCA, which reflect their adherence to industry standards and safety protocols.
